Here are some of the Selba Happy Hour details for your Happy Hour consideration. It's great spot for a large group to gather at the bar with plenty of room for conversation without being in the way of staff and other patrons. Happy hour is from 5pm to 7pm. Daily deals include $3 rail drinks, $2 off wine and $1 off beer. Thursdays they have $5 martinis! We loved it and will be keeping it in the rotation.

Our goals for last week were primarily health related and we knocked them all out. The diet bet has begun-we are officially weighed in and on our way toward winning our share of the money pot! The goal of this game is to lose 4% of our starting weight within 28 days. This works out to roughly 6 pounds for each of us. To play the game, you pay a set amount for the bet (our bet was $25). Everyone playing that meets or exceeds the 4% weight loss goal splits the pot!  We only have 4 participants, so someone could win $100. Hopefully we'll all reach our goal and just win our $25 back.
